I've figured out a bunch during the process. The lever between the legs is rear brake.
And the two levers on the handlebars are also rear brakes. :) no front brakes needed.
The mechanism for the brakes is just a little wheel(toothless gear) integrated into the rear axle, and when the lever is activated, a piece of "fabric" tightens around the wheel slowing down the axle.
